The Constitution of the United States of America provides us the opportunity and the 1952 US Supreme Court decision, Zorach vs Clauson 343 U.S. 306 (1952) provides the parameters. 

Every school district can have a LifeWise Academy with the following 3 conditions: (1) The students must be off school property; (2) Every student enrolled must have parent permission; and (3) the program must be privately funded.
